Grasp Your Credit Score: A Roadmap to Secure Finances

Your credit score is a vital factor in your financial well-being. Serves as an indicator of your creditworthiness, influencing your ability to secure loans, rent apartments, and even obtain favorable insurance rates. Building a strong credit score requires understanding how it is calculated and utilizing sound financial practices.

Begin with reviewing your credit report regularly for errors or inaccuracies. Dispute any discrepancies promptly to ensure its accuracy. Practice responsible credit card usage by paying your bills on time and keeping your credit utilization ratio low. Research other factors that can impact your score, such as your payment history.

Remember, building a strong credit score is a marathon, not a sprint. Be patient and persevere in your efforts to establish a positive financial foundation.

Securing Your Online Presence

In today's digital world, your digital footprint is more valuable than ever. Criminals are constantly seeking ways to exploit vulnerabilities and steal sensitive data. That's why it's crucial to develop a strong Identity IQ.

By understanding the threats associated with online activity, you can take proactive steps to protect yourself from cyberattacks. A robust Identity IQ involves a combination of best practices, including:

* Using strong and unique credentials for every account.

* Being cautious read more about the data you share online.

* Regularly monitoring your credit report for suspicious transactions.

By taking these steps, you can help safeguard your online identity. Remember, a strong Identity IQ is an ongoing process, so stay informed and update your practices as needed.
